Dolphins Consider Signing Asante Samuel Jr. to Bolster Cornerback Depth

10 months agoUS
Dolphins Consider Signing Asante Samuel Jr. to Bolster Cornerback DepthSource: sports.yahoo.com
The Miami Dolphins are exploring options to strengthen their cornerback position and have reportedly shown interest in free agent Asante Samuel Jr. The team's need for experienced depth in the secondary is evident following offseason moves and injuries.

Key Insights

Asante Samuel Jr., a former second-round pick by the Los Angeles Chargers, is a free agent and has reportedly been in contact with the Dolphins.

Samuel Jr. has played in 50 career games with 47 starts and has six career interceptions, showcasing his potential impact.

The Dolphins' cornerback situation is currently uncertain, with several players lacking extensive starting experience.

Concerns exist regarding Samuel Jr.'s health, as he underwent neck surgery in April and had a shoulder injury last season.

Why does this matter? The Dolphins are looking to improve their defense, and adding a player with Samuel Jr.'s experience could provide a significant boost. However, his health is a major consideration.

In-Depth Analysis

The Dolphins' cornerback situation has been in flux this offseason, with the team trading Jalen Ramsey and allowing Kendall Fuller to enter free agency. While they've added veterans like Jack Jones and Mike Hilton, the overall experience level at the position remains a concern. Asante Samuel Jr. could provide a solution, bringing a proven track record and potential for impactful plays.

Samuel, who will turn 26 in October, had a strong 2023 season according to PFF, with an overall grade of 73.9 and a coverage grade of 75.6. However, he was limited to just four games last season due to injuries, raising questions about his durability.

The Dolphins' current cornerback options include Cornell Armstrong, Kendall Sheffield, Storm Duck, Jack Jones, and Cam Smith. While some of these players have shown promise, none are considered established starters, making the potential addition of Samuel Jr. a significant one.
